Nemotron 3 VoiceChat vs NV-EmbedCode 7B v1

Nemotron 3 VoiceChat (2026) and NV-EmbedCode 7B v1 (2025) are compact production models from NVIDIA AI. Nemotron 3 VoiceChat ships a not-yet-sourced context window, while NV-EmbedCode 7B v1 ships a 4K-token context window.
